Utoy Creek is a wastewater testing facility. It includes BSL-2 lab space, office space, auditorium, research and teaching lab, and toxicity lab. The new administration/laboratory building of the improved Utoy Creek WRC is a state-of-the-art facility designed to protect the environment, to provide education and public meeting facilities, and to be a safe, comfortable place to work.
Built into the side of a hill overlooking the water treatment plant, the building provides an uninterrupted view of the entire plant for twenty-four-hour-a-day monitoring to ensure plant security and proper operation. The interior laboratory spaces each have skylights so visitors can watch lab work in progress and so co-workers are aware of laboratory activities to help insure safety.
